Description:Metaphysics: An Introduction, Second Edition combines comprehensive coverage of the core elements of metaphysics with contemporary and lively debates within the subject. It provides a rigorous and yet accessible overview of a rich array of topics, connecting the abstract nature of metaphysics with the real world. Topics covered include:
basic logic for metaphysics
an introduction to ontology
abstract objects
material objects
critiques of metaphysics
natural and social kinds
the metaphysics of race and gender
grounding and fundamentality
free will
time
modality
persistence
causation.
